Kohmura C, Gold HK, Yasuda T, Holt R, Nedelman MA, Guerrero JL, Weisman HF, Collen D. A chimeric murine/human antibody Fab fragment directed against the platelet GPIIb/IIIa receptor enhances and sustains arterial thrombolysis with recombinant tissue-type plasminogen activator in baboons. ARTERIOSCLEROSIS AND THROMBOSIS : A JOURNAL OF VASCULAR BIOLOGY 1993; 13:1837-42. [PMID: 8241105 DOI: 10.1161/01.atv.13.12.1837] [Citation(s) in RCA: 25] [Impact Index Per Article: 0.8] [Reference Citation Analysis] [Abstract] [MESH Headings] [Track Full Text] [Subscribe] [Scholar Register] [Indexed: 01/29/2023]
Abstract
Inhibition of the platelet glycoprotein (GP) IIb/IIIa receptor with the murine monoclonal antibody 7E3 abolishes ex vivo platelet aggregation, reduces thrombogenicity, and sustains arterial recanalization with recombinant tissue-type plasminogen activator (rt-PA). A chimeric murine/human Fab fragment of 7E3 (c7E3-Fab) has a markedly reduced immunogenicity, but its potency as an adjunct for thrombolysis with rt-PA has not been evaluated. The effects of a single intravenous bolus injection of aspirin (17 mg/kg) or c7E3-Fab (0.45 mg/kg) on thrombolysis and reocclusion induced with rt-PA were studied in groups of six baboons with femoral arterial thrombosis and superimposed high-grade stenosis. This dose of c7E3-Fab blocked 96 +/- 1% of the platelet GPIIb/IIIa receptors and abolished ADP-induced platelet aggregation. Bolus intravenous injections of rt-PA (0.25 mg/kg) were repeated at 15-minute intervals until reperfusion occurred (maximum of four injections). In the aspirin group, reperfusion was obtained within 51 +/- 16 minutes (mean +/- SD) but was rapidly followed by reocclusion within 6 +/- 9 minutes and by cyclic reflow and reocclusion. In the c7E3-Fab group, reperfusion was obtained within 25 +/- 8 minutes (P < .01 versus aspirin group) and was associated with a delayed reocclusion of 63 +/- 63 minutes (P < .05 versus aspirin group). Template bleeding times remained unchanged in the aspirin/rt-PA group but were markedly prolonged (to > 30 minutes) in the c7E3-Fab/rt-PA group.(ABSTRACT TRUNCATED AT 250 WORDS)

Goss RJ, Holt R. Epimorphic vs. tissue regeneration in Xenopus forelimbs. THE JOURNAL OF EXPERIMENTAL ZOOLOGY 1992; 261:451-7. [PMID: 1569412 DOI: 10.1002/jez.1402610412] [Citation(s) in RCA: 30] [Impact Index Per Article: 0.9] [Reference Citation Analysis] [Abstract] [MESH Headings] [Track Full Text] [Subscribe] [Scholar Register] [Indexed: 12/27/2022]
Abstract
Postmetamorphic froglets of Xenopus laevis regenerate hypomorphic unbranched spikes from amputated arm stumps. These are composed primarily of cartilage, produced from blastemalike structures sparsely populated with cells and rich in connective tissue. Some consider these outgrowths to be an example of epimorphic regeneration produced from blastemas, albeit deficient ones. Others interpret them as a case of tissue regeneration derived from fibroblastemas augmented by chondrocytes and periosteal and perichondrial fibroblasts. To resolve these alternatives, forelimbs were amputated proximal to the wrist, skinned, and inserted through the body wall into the abdominal cavity. In the absence of skin, epidermal wound healing failed to occur and blastemas could not develop. After 2 months, by which time controls had regenerated spikes averaging 3.38 mm long, the denuded stumps had not given rise to outgrowths. They typically developed cartilaginous caps on the severed ends of the radius-ulna, and in rare cases formed amorphous growths of cartilage. If blastema formation is considered diagnostic of epimorphic regeneration and tissue regeneration can proceed in the absence of epidermal wound healing and blastema formation, these findings lead to the conclusion that Xenopus limb regeneration is epimorphic.

Holt R. RU 486/prostaglandin: considerations for appropriate use in low-resource settings. LAW, MEDICINE & HEALTH CARE : A PUBLICATION OF THE AMERICAN SOCIETY OF LAW & MEDICINE 1992; 20:169-83. [PMID: 1434758 DOI: 10.1111/j.1748-720x.1992.tb01185.x] [Citation(s) in RCA: 6] [Impact Index Per Article: 0.2] [Reference Citation Analysis] [Abstract] [Key Words] [MESH Headings] [Track Full Text] [Subscribe] [Scholar Register] [Indexed: 12/27/2022]
Abstract
Antiprogestins represent a new class of promising drugs in fertility regulation, especially in early termination of pregnancy. RU 486 (mifepristone), manufactured by Roussel-Uclaf and marketed under the international trade name Mifegyne, is an antiprogestin tablet that is used sequentially with a prostaglandin for non-surgical termination of pregnancy. It has been chosen as a pregnancy termination method by over 100,000 women in France since its regulatory approval there in 1988. In addition, RU 486/prostaglandin was approved in July 1991 for use in the United Kingdom and an application for approval is being considered in Sweden. In Western Europe, it seems, RU 486/prostaglandin is increasingly accepted by medical experts, regulatory officials and women as an alternative to vacuum aspiration or dilation and curettage (D&C) for early pregnancy termination.As the use of RU 486/prostaglandin becomes more established, health practitioners and women's health advocates are beginning to consider the feasibility of using this method for pregnancy termination in low-resource settings.

Yasuda T, Gold HK, Leinbach RC, Saito T, Guerrero JL, Jang IK, Holt R, Fallon JT, Collen D. Lysis of plasminogen activator-resistant platelet-rich coronary artery thrombus with combined bolus injection of recombinant tissue-type plasminogen activator and antiplatelet GPIIb/IIIa antibody. J Am Coll Cardiol 1990; 16:1728-35. [PMID: 2123910 DOI: 10.1016/0735-1097(90)90327-l] [Citation(s) in RCA: 87] [Impact Index Per Article: 2.6] [Reference Citation Analysis] [Abstract] [MESH Headings] [Grants] [Track Full Text] [Journal Information] [Submit a Manuscript] [Subscribe] [Scholar Register] [Indexed: 12/30/2022]
Abstract
Resistance of coronary occlusive thrombus to thrombolytic therapy, found in some patients with acute myocardial infarction, may be due to the presence of platelet-rich coronary clot. Reperfusion therapy in such patients may require the development and evaluation of alternative strategies in animal models. Therefore, platelet-rich coronary artery thrombus was developed by excision, eversion (inside out) and reanastomosis of a 1 cm segment of the left circumflex coronary artery in anesthetized dogs maintained on heparin antiocoagulation. Blood flow was restored in 25 of 27 dogs. Thrombotic occlusion of the everted segment graft with primarily platelet-rich thrombus or thrombus containing platelet-rich and erythrocyte-rich zones, persisting for at least 30 min, occurred within 4.5 +/- 3.5 min (mean +/- SD) in 20 of these 25 dogs. In 5 of these 20 dogs (group I, control), stable occlusion, as monitored with an ultrasound flow probe and coronary angiography, was maintained during a 2 h observation period. In group II (n = 5), intravenous bolus injections of recombinant tissue-type plasminogen activator (rt-PA) at a dose of 0.45 mg/kg body weight at four 15 min intervals did not cause reperfusion in four dogs and produced cyclic reperfusion and reocclusion in one dog. In group III (n = 5), a single intravenous bolus injection of 0.8 mg/kg of the F(ab')2 fragment of a murine monoclonal antibody (7E3) against the human platelet GPIIb/IIIa receptor [7E3-F(ab')2] produced stable reperfusion in two of the five dogs, whereas occlusion persisted in the other three. In group IV (n = 5), injection of 7E3-F(ab')2 (0.8 mg/kg) followed by rt-PA (0.45 mg/kg) caused stable reperfusion without reocclusion in all dogs (p less than 0.05 versus rt-PA alone and p less than 0.01 versus control). This study confirms that platelet-rich occlusive coronary thrombus is very resistant to lysis with intravenous rt-PA. However, this resistance may be overcome by the combined use of a reduced dose of rt-PA and the antiplatelet GPIIb/IIIa receptor antibody 7E3. The results indicate that platelet-rich thrombus resistant to thrombolytic agents may be dispersed pharmacologically without resort to mechanical recanalization. The present dog model may be useful in investigating specific strategies for the dispersion of resistant platelet-rich coronary thrombus.

Denham SA, McKinley M, Couchoud EA, Holt R. Emotional and behavioral predictors of preschool peer ratings. Child Dev 1990; 61:1145-52. [PMID: 2209184] [Citation(s) in RCA: 0] [Impact Index Per Article: 0] [Reference Citation Analysis] [Abstract] [MESH Headings] [Journal Information] [Subscribe] [Scholar Register] [Indexed: 12/30/2022]
Abstract
It was predicted that social cognitive, behavioral, and affective aspects of young children's social development would predict stable peer ratings of their likability. Measures of likability, emotion knowledge, prosocial and aggressive behavior, peer competence, and expressed emotions (happy and angry) were obtained for 65 subjects (mean age = 44 months). Sociometric ratings, particularly negative, were stable over 1- and 9-month time periods. Correlational analyses showed that emotion knowledge and prosocial behavior were direct predictors of likability. Prosocial behavior mediated the relations of gender and expressed emotions with likability (i.e., gender and expressed emotions were each related to prosocial behavior, and prosocial behavior was related to likability, but neither gender nor expressed emotions were related to likability with prosocial behavior partialled out). Knowledge of emotional situations similarly mediated the age-likability relation. Results uphold the early development of stable peer reputations and the hypothesized centrality of emotion-related predictors of likability.

Gold HK, Gimple LW, Yasuda T, Leinbach RC, Werner W, Holt R, Jordan R, Berger H, Collen D, Coller BS. Pharmacodynamic study of F(ab')2 fragments of murine monoclonal antibody 7E3 directed against human platelet glycoprotein IIb/IIIa in patients with unstable angina pectoris. J Clin Invest 1990; 86:651-9. [PMID: 2384607 PMCID: PMC296773 DOI: 10.1172/jci114757] [Citation(s) in RCA: 150] [Impact Index Per Article: 4.4] [Reference Citation Analysis] [Abstract] [MESH Headings] [Grants] [Track Full Text] [Journal Information] [Subscribe] [Scholar Register] [Indexed: 12/31/2022] Open
Abstract
The pharmacodynamics of intravenous bolus injections of 0.05, 0.10, 0.15, and 0.20 mg/kg of F(ab')2 fragments of the murine monoclonal antibody 7E3, 7E3-F(ab')2, directed against the glycoprotein IIb/IIIa (GPIIb/IIIa) receptor of human platelets, were studied in groups of four patients with unstable angina pectoris. With 0.20 mg/kg, the template bleeding time prolonged from 6.3 +/- 1.9 (mean +/- SD) to greater than 30 min; it subsequently decreased to 13 +/- 7.8 min after 12 h and to 8.3 +/- 1.5 min after 24 h. The number of unblocked GPIIb/IIIa receptors (preinfusion value, 32,000 +/- 3,000 per platelet) decreased to 13 +/- 7% of the preinfusion value 1 h after infusion, and then increased to 33 +/- 10% at 12 h, 44 +/- 8% at 24 h and 67 +/- 7% at 72 h. The logarithm of the bleeding time was inversely proportional with the residual GPIIb/IIIa receptors (r = 0.73, P less than 0.0001). ADP-induced platelet aggregation (measured by changes in light transmittance in percent) decreased from 60 +/- 5% before infusion to 1.5 +/- 3% 1 h after infusion; it then increased to 29 +/- 3% after 24 h and 39 +/- 6% after 72 h. Platelet counts decreased by 16% at 1 h and returned to control values within 24 h. Proportionally smaller effects were seen at lower doses of 7E3-F(ab')2. Antibody injection did not induce spontaneous bleeding. Angina was not observed during the first 12 h when the bleeding time was significantly prolonged, but occurred in 6 of the 16 patients within the next 3 d. 2 of the 16 patients developed low titers of IgG antibodies specific for 7E3-F(ab')2. Thus 7E3-F(ab')2 induces dose-related inhibition of platelet function; at a dose of 0.20 mg/kg, it causes profound inhibition of platelet aggregation and prolongation of the bleeding time, but no spontaneous bleeding.

Dritschilo A, Harter KW, Thomas D, Nauta R, Holt R, Lee TC, Rustgi S, Rodgers J. Intraoperative radiation therapy of hepatic metastases: technical aspects and report of a pilot study. Int J Radiat Oncol Biol Phys 1988; 14:1007-11. [PMID: 3360645 DOI: 10.1016/0360-3016(88)90026-0] [Citation(s) in RCA: 35] [Impact Index Per Article: 1.0] [Reference Citation Analysis] [Abstract] [MESH Headings] [Track Full Text] [Journal Information] [Subscribe] [Scholar Register] [Indexed: 01/05/2023]
Abstract
Surgical resection of hepatic metastases offers long-term survival, and possible cure, for selected patients with colorectal carcinoma. Fifty percent of patients considered candidates for resection are found to have disease confined to the liver. The resections necessary are often more extensive than predicted preoperatively, which provides an opportunity for innovative approaches using radiation therapy. The intraoperative radiation therapy technique presented here offers the ability to control multiple metastatic deposits in patients not deemed resectable. This is achieved using remote afterloading interstitial (Ir-192) radiation therapy to deliver tumoricidal radiation doses to limited volumes within the liver. The technique was used to treat 11 patients in a pilot study, delivering radiation doses of 20 Gy to the periphery of predetermined target volumes in a single treatment. The number of metastatic deposits treated ranged from 2 to 11 separate tumors with maximum diameters from 3 to 9 cm (median 6 cm). Hospitalizations were from 6 to 23 days (median 8) with only one patient experiencing a surgically related complication (wound dehiscence and pneumonia). There were no radiation related complications on follow-up to 18 months. Biopsies of two treated sites in a patient undergoing reoperation confirmed control of tumors by this procedure. This technique is offered as a standby procedure to patients undergoing exploration for hepatic resection at our institution.

Feller WF, Holt R, Spear S, Little JW. Modified radical mastectomy with immediate breast reconstruction. Am Surg 1986; 52:129-33. [PMID: 3006563] [Citation(s) in RCA: 0] [Impact Index Per Article: 0] [Reference Citation Analysis] [Abstract] [MESH Headings] [Journal Information] [Subscribe] [Scholar Register] [Indexed: 01/03/2023]
Abstract
The authors reviewed 100 consecutive patients with breast cancer treated by modified radical mastectomy and immediate breast reconstruction in order to assess the safety and efficacy of this procedure in terms of cancer control. The study began in 1978 and is continuing. The procedure involves a two-team approach with both the general surgeon and the plastic surgeon interviewing the patient preoperatively. Virtually all breast reconstruction involved the use of a submuscular silicone saline type of implant. The median follow-up is 36 months. Slightly over half of these cases were Stage 0 or Stage I. There have been eight recurrences, including five local or regional and three distant. No patient has died of her disease at this point. Cosmesis was equal to or superior to that seen in delayed breast reconstruction. There have been no hidden recurrences. Postoperative depression has been significantly less. We conclude that modified radical mastectomy with immediate breast reconstruction is a safe and effective alternative to modified radical mastectomy alone.

Holt R. The early serological detection of colonisation by Staphylococcus epidermidis of ventriculo-atrial shunts. Infection 1980; 8:8-12. [PMID: 7372358 DOI: 10.1007/bf01677392] [Citation(s) in RCA: 5] [Impact Index Per Article: 0.1] [Reference Citation Analysis] [Abstract] [MESH Headings] [Track Full Text] [Journal Information] [Subscribe] [Scholar Register] [Indexed: 01/24/2023]
Abstract
Simple quantitative serological tests demonstrating Staphylococcus epidermidis agglutinins and C-reactive protein were used for the early detection of ventriculo-atrial shunt colonization by this organism. Tests in normal children and adults in various age groups throughout life confirmed Bayston's ovservations that those tested attained a titre up to 1:160 TO S. epidermidis agglutinogen. In contrast, the titre in children with colonised shunts and in adults with S. epidermidis endocarditis, both conditions which are usually accompanied by bacteraemia, rose to much higher levels, sometimes up to 1:5120. The routine combination of both tests has proven to be of considerable diagnostic value, particularly in early or recent colonisation.

Clancy J, Chapman AL, Holt R. Growth of a heterologous tumor cell line in neonatal rats with graft-versus-host disease. J Natl Cancer Inst 1977; 58:1279-85. [PMID: 16141 DOI: 10.1093/jnci/58.5.1279] [Citation(s) in RCA: 0] [Impact Index Per Article: 0] [Reference Citation Analysis] [Abstract] [MESH Headings] [Track Full Text] [Journal Information] [Subscribe] [Scholar Register] [Indexed: 12/12/2022] Open
Abstract
The ability of a hamster tumor cell line (T20) to grow and exhibit type H virus particles was significantly enhanced in neonatal DA rats with graft-versus-host disease (GVHD). Tumor growth peaked on days 4 and 7 in control littermates receiving adult syngeneic cells or no cells at birth, respectively, and then subsequently disappeared. However, tumor nodules in animals with GVHD became significantly larger than those in controls by day 7 and continued to grow until death. In addition, a marked plasma cell infiltration was noticed in such rapidly growing tumors from animals with GVHD only. In the light of previous studies, evidence is discussed for an environment within animals with GVHD conducive for tumor cell growth because of a depletion of T-cell areas within their tissues.

Cobb CM, Holt R, Denys FR. Ultrastructural features of the verruciform xanthoma. JOURNAL OF ORAL PATHOLOGY 1976; 5:42-51. [PMID: 814219 DOI: 10.1111/j.1600-0714.1976.tb01756.x] [Citation(s) in RCA: 49] [Impact Index Per Article: 1.0] [Reference Citation Analysis] [Abstract] [MESH Headings] [Track Full Text] [Subscribe] [Scholar Register] [Indexed: 12/24/2022]
Abstract
The verruciform xanthoma, a rare lesion of the oral cavity, was studied by light and electron microscopy. The major cell type associated with the lesion was shown to contain appreciable amounts of lipid and was characterized as a macrophage. It was characteristic of the endothelial cells associated with subepithelial capillaries to exhibit multiple basal laminae. A rather unusual observation was the migration of lipid-filled cells into the stratum germinativum of the overlying epithelium.
